The Delhi Special Police Establishment (DSPE) Act,1946
4. Superintendence and administration of Special Police Establishment
1The Superintendence of the Delhi Special Police Establishment insofar as it relates to investigation of offences alleged to have been committed under the Prevention of Corruption Act,1988 (49 of 1988), shall vest in the Commission.
—————–
1. Subs. by Act 45 of 2003, sec. 26 (w.e.f. 11-9-2003), for section 4 “Superintendence and administration of special police establishment.
(i) The Superintendence of the Delhi Special Police Establishment shall vest in the Central Government.
(ii) The administration of the said police establishment shall vest in an officer appointed in this behalf by the Central Government who shall exercise in respect of that police establishment such of the powers exercisable by an Inspector-General of Police in respect of the Police force in a State, as the Central Government may specify in this behalf.”
(iii) Save as otherwise provided in sub-section (1), the superintendence of the said police establishment in all other matters shall vest in the Central Government.
(iv) The administration of the said police establishment shall vest in an officer appointed in this behalf by the Central Government (hereinafter referred to as the Director) who shall exercise in respect of that police establishment such of the powers exercisable by an Inspector-General of Police in respect of the police force in a State as the Central Government may specify in this behalf.
